“You can’t identify the prostatic or common ejaculatory ducts I’m afraid. But you could plan to be conservative at the bladder neck and where the ducts emerge in the hope for higher rates.”
You can easily see where the ducts emerge on the veru with the scope that is part of the handpiece instrument and most experienced urologists should know the approximate path the main ejaculatory ducts take from the seminal vesicles which are visible on the ultrasound. They typically run posterior laterally and angle toward the veru from below. Given the position of the hand piece probe that contains the water jet aperture (pressed up against the anterior surface of the urethra) and that the maximum cut depth is 25mm (~2.5cm) the water jet is not capable of reaching the depth where the ejaculatory ducts run except in the apex where they approach and enter the veru from below on all but the smallest prostates. This is why the software contains an adjustable veru protection zone that limits the sweep angle of the jet so that it cannot go below 52 degrees on either side resulting in the so-called “butterfly cut” and also why the surgeon can raise the cut profile in the sagittal plane to limit the maximum cut depth anywhere along the axis of the probe.

I don’t know what you mean by “everything” but that is not true either. In fact, it’s not POSSIBLE in prostates above a fairly small size. The water jet has limits on maximum sweep angle and cut depth. It can’t ablate anything outside of that envelope unless the hand piece is repositioned following the first cut which I’ve never heard of being done.
I think you’ve also claimed before that once the robot starts a resection pass it can’t be stopped or changed until it finishes. That also is untrue. The system as described in the 2017 FDA document includes a foot switch that starts the resection when depressed and halts it when lifted. In the conformal planning unit video from my procedure that I’ve watched multiple times it is obvious that not only is it possible to stop and end a pass before it’s completed, my surgeon did that to make some adjustments during one of the two passes.
Urolift has two things going for it. It never causes sexual side effects (unique in that regard) and it can be done in-office without general or spinal anesthesia. However it does have some risks other procedures don’t and on average is not as effective as procedures that remove tissue.
